Overview

The 2014 KTM 250 XC stands as a formidable contender in the cross-motocross category, epitomizing the brand's commitment to blending performance with agility. Designed for both competitive racers and dedicated trail enthusiasts, this lightweight two-stroke motorcycle offers the perfect balance of power and maneuverability. With KTM's signature orange and black livery, it not only commands attention on the track but also embodies the rugged essence of off-road riding. Whether you’re navigating tight woods or hitting the motocross track, the 250 XC is engineered to deliver an exhilarating experience. At the heart of the 250 XC lies a robust 249cc single-cylinder engine that showcases KTM's expertise in two-stroke technology. With a bore and stroke measuring 66.4 x 72.0 mm, this powerhouse generates a thrilling rush of torque, providing riders with the acceleration they crave. The liquid cooling system ensures optimal engine performance even in the most challenging conditions, while the 6-speed gearbox allows for seamless gear shifts, enhancing both control and responsiveness. Whether you're blasting through a straightaway or tackling tricky terrain, the combination of power and precision makes the 250 XC a thrilling ride that encourages confidence and skill. The chassis of the 2014 KTM 250 XC is equally impressive, featuring a central tube frame crafted from chrome molybdenum steel, which is both lightweight and durable. This design not only contributes to the bike’s overall low weight of 103.9 kg (229.1 pounds) but also enhances stability and handling. The WP Suspension system, complete with a 300 mm front travel and 317 mm rear travel, absorbs impacts with grace, allowing riders to traverse rough landscapes with ease. Additionally, the dual braking system—featuring a 260 mm front disc and a 220 mm rear disc—provides exceptional stopping power, giving riders the confidence to push their limits. With both electric and kick start options, the 250 XC is ready to tackle any adventure at a moment's notice. **

Pros

  • Lightweight and Agile: Weighing just 103.9 kg, the 250 XC is designed for nimble maneuverability, making it perfect for tight trails and competitive racing.
  • Powerful Engine Performance: The 249cc two-stroke engine delivers impressive torque and acceleration, ensuring a thrilling riding experience.
  • Advanced Suspension System: The WP Suspension offers superior travel and handling, providing excellent traction and comfort over rough terrain.

Cons

  • High Seat Height: With a seat height of 992 mm, it may not be suitable for shorter riders, making it challenging to handle at low speeds or when stopped.
  • Limited Fuel Capacity: The 10-liter fuel tank may require more frequent refueling during long rides or extended trail sessions.
  • Two-Stroke Maintenance: The two-stroke engine typically requires more regular maintenance and attention compared to four-stroke counterparts, which may deter some riders.

Technical details

Source specification data

Make
KTM
Model
250 XC
Category
Cross-motocross
Starter
Electric & kick
Color Options
Orange/Black
Clutch
Multidisc
clutch
S
in oil bath/hydraulically activated
Gearbox
6-speed
Driveline
5/8 x 1/4
Engine Type
Reed intake.
Bore X Stroke
66.4 x 72.0 mm (2.6 x 2.8 inches)
Displacement
249.00 ccm (15.19 cubic inches)
Cooling System
Liquid
Engine Details
Single cylinder, two-stroke
Transmission Type Final Drive
Chain
Dry Weight
103.9 kg (229.1 pounds)
Seat Height
992 mm (39.1 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ting.
Fuel Capacity
10.00 litres (2.64 gallons)
Ground Clearance
395 mm (15.6 inches)
Rake
26.5°
Frame Type
Central tube frame made of chrome molybdenum steel tubing
Rear Brakes
Single disc
Front Brakes
Single disc
Rear Suspension
WP  Suspension 5018 BAVP DCC
Front Suspension
WP  Suspension Up Side Down 4860 MXMA CC
Rear Wheel Travel
317 mm (12.5 inches)
Front Wheel Travel
300 mm (11.8 inches)
Rear Brakes Diameter
220 mm (8.7 inches)
Front Brakes Diameter
260 mm (10.2 inches)
